Who is Hans Zimmer?

Hans Zimmer is one of the most influential film composers of our time. He has scored over 500 projects across film, television, and video games. (Hans Zimmer Live)
He’s earned multiple awards including Oscars, Grammys, Golden Globes — making him a leading figure in cinematic music. (Paris La Défense Arena)
His style spans epic orchestral works, electronic hybrid textures, and memorable themes that live on outside of the films themselves.


What to Expect at a Hans Zimmer Concert

1. A Vast and Varied Set List

At a Hans Zimmer concert you can expect to hear tracks from major films like Gladiator, Pirates of the Caribbean, Dune, Inception, The Lion King, and more. (soundtrackfest.com)
These pieces are often rearranged for a live setting to heighten the drama, the emotional impact, and the communal thrill of concert‐going.

2. A Full Orchestra + Live Band

Rather than just a back-drop of recorded music, these concerts typically feature a full orchestra, choir, and in many cases a live band, all performing under Zimmer’s direction (or his production/curation team). (Pollstar News)
That live ensemble adds layers of depth to the music — something you can feel physically in the venue.

3. Immersive Audio-Visual Experience

Zimmer’s concerts are built to impress not just with sound, but with visuals: lighting effects, stage design, sometimes video backdrops that sync with the music. His latest production, “The Next Level”, promises exactly this. (Paris La Défense Arena)
It’s not just about sitting and listening — it’s about being immersed.

4. Emotional Impact

Whether you’re a longtime Zimmer fan or new to his work, the live experience often brings fresh emotion. The familiarity of the film themes combined with the live power of orchestra can create a sense of catharsis, excitement, nostalgia.


The Current Tour: “The Next Level” & Other Highlights

Zimmer’s new production — titled The Next Level — is scheduled for Europe during 2025-2026. (Hans Zimmer Live)
Here are some key details:

  • The official website lists many European dates (Amsterdam, London, Paris, Stockholm etc.) for late 2025 and early 2026. (Hans Zimmer Live)
  • For example, Paris La Défense Arena on 21 November 2025 is one such date. (Paris La Défense)
  • Similarly, there were Asia & Australia dates earlier in 2025 with full orchestra & band. (Pollstar News)

Tips for Attending & Getting the Most Out of It

  • Book Early: Tickets to Zimmer’s shows often sell out quickly, especially prime seats. Reddit users note how quickly UK/Europe dates were snapped up. (reddit.com)
  • Check the Artist Presence: In some versions of the “World of Hans Zimmer” shows, Zimmer himself does not perform live on stage — he may serve as curator or musical director. > “Within five minutes of buying tickets … I discovered he won’t appear in person.” (reddit.com)
    So if seeing Zimmer himself is important to you, look for wording like “Hans Zimmer Live” vs. “The Music of Hans Zimmer” or “World of Hans Zimmer”.
  • Arrive Early: Large venues, complex staging, and big crowds mean you’ll want time to settle in.
  • Choose Good Sound Sections: With orchestras and full bands, acoustic variation is large. Mid-arena or near the front of sections often works best.
  • Mind the Dress Code & Atmosphere: These concerts may have a slightly upscale or formal feel (though you won’t need a tux). But they’re more than just “pop concerts” — many attendees treat them as special occasions.
  • Enjoy the Full Experience: Take time to absorb the visuals, video cues, the orchestra tuning, and the moment when a big theme drops. It’s a theatrical experience as much as a concert.

2. Does Hans Zimmer perform live at every concert?

Not always. There are two main types of shows:

  • Hans Zimmer Live – Hans Zimmer himself performs on stage with his band and orchestra.
  • The World of Hans Zimmer – a concert featuring his music, but usually curated by him, without his personal stage appearance.
    Always check the concert’s official website or event description to confirm.

3. How long does a Hans Zimmer concert last?

Most Hans Zimmer concerts run for about 2 to 3 hours, including a short intermission. The show usually features 15–20 pieces from his most iconic film scores.
